WHAT IS A COOKIE?

A cookie is a small file stored on your device that helps us anonymously identify your browser from page to page and visit to visit, improving your experience on our website. If you're unfamiliar with cookies, or how to manage them, we recommend visiting reliable sources like Your Online Choices for guidance on how to control or delete cookies.

HOW DO COOKIES WORK?

When you visit our website for the first time, a cookie is downloaded to your device. Cookies can store various types of information, such as your language preferences. The next time you visit, your browser checks for a cookie and sends information back to our site, allowing us to tailor content specifically for you.
